    Production Manager (Wheat Mill) (Harrismith)

    Description

    • To drive the technical performance of raw material and product processes to achieve optimum productivity and world-class quality standards, while maintaining operational costs within budget.

    Requirements

    Minimum Requirements

    • Grade 12 (Matric)
    • Qualified Wheat Miller (GMF)
    • Minimum of 5 years’ relevant experience in a wheat milling environment

    Key Performance Areas

    • Lead regular operational meetings, ensure effective information flow across departments, compile performance reports, and align team efforts with company values and goals.
    • Drive technical performance, optimise milling processes, and ensure equipment efficiency.
    • Maintain consistent product quality, manage grading and compliance with HACCP and ISO standards.
    • Monitor and control operational costs, ensuring alignment with budget targets.
    • Manage and develop technical staff, enforce policies, and lead performance appraisals.
    • Oversee infestation control, hygiene standards, and safe use of fumigation practices.
    • Implement innovative solutions, manage non-conformance processes, and drive training initiatives.

    Technical Competencies

    • Strong management, leadership, and interpersonal skills
    • Excellent verbal and written communication
    • In-depth knowledge of grading regulations
    • Mechanical aptitude and problem-solving ability
    • Crisis management and decision-making under pressure
    • Compliance with world-class manufacturing standards

    Behavioural Competencies

    • Accountability and reliability
    • Hardworking and willing to work overtime
    • Innovation and proactive thinking
    • Quality and safety orientation
    • Positive attitude and team collaboration

    Technician: Construction and Forestry (Salt Rock)

    Description

    • Repair and maintain construction and forestry and related equipment as a service

    Requirements

    REQUIRED MINIMUM EDUCATION/TRAINING    

    • N2 Qualified Technician

    REQUIRED MINIMUM WORK EXPERIENCE            

    • 3 years’ relevant experience (including training as Apprentice)

    KEY PERFORMANCE AREAS         

    • Perform repairs and maintenance of construction and forestry equipment.
    • Build and maintain good customer relationships and ensure that customer queries and complaints are resolved within the prescribed turnaround time.
    • Update job cards.
    • Maintain a safe work environment and ensure that protective equipment is used as prescribed.
    • Ensure compliance with health and safety regulations

    TECHNICAL KNOWLEDGE/ COMPETENCIES          

    • Good product knowledge in the repair and maintenance of construction and forestry equipment
    • Good time-keeping abilities
    • Communication skills
    • Driver's licence

    BEHAVIOURAL COMPETENCIES 

    • Willingness to work in hot areas as well as outside locations
    • Good time management
    • Energetic and self-motivated
    • Safety cautious
    • Problem analysis
    • Focus on quality
    • Accountability
    • Ability to work alone as well as in a team
    • Good customer service and interpersonal behaviour

    Millwright (Milling) (Bethal)

    Description

    • To ensure the efficient and effective operation of electric works and mechanical repairs.

    Requirements

    REQUIRED MINIMUM EDUCATION/TRAINING    

    • N3 or Grade 12
    • Trade Test Electrical and Mechanical 

    REQUIRED MINIMUM WORK EXPERIENCE            

    • Minimum 3 years experience as a Millwright.

    KEY PERFORMANCE AREAS         

    • Perform Plant maintenance: Electrical and Mechanical.
    • Perform inspections and breakdown repairs on production machinery/equipment.
    • Performing tasks as per reasonable instruction from Engineering Foreman.
    • Execute minor projects to improve facilities.
    • Keep the work area clean and ensure compliance with health and safety policies.

    TECHNICAL KNOWLEDGE/ COMPETENCIES          

    • Mechanical and Electrical inclined
    • Problem-solving
    • Crisis management     

    BEHAVIOURAL COMPETENCIES 

    • Self-starter, Hands-on
    • Work and operate independently
    • Ability to troubleshoot, remain calm and initiate effective solutions in crisis
